Systems Engineer - Electrical Systems Integrator
Lockheed Martin is a leader in space exploration and defense, known for its innovative thinking and collaborative partnerships. They are seeking an Electrical Systems Integrator to support a new missile defense program, focusing on electrical integration and system-level data management.

Responsibilities
Work with vehicle instrumentation including test and flight data requirements, sensor and channel database, and instrumentation installation definition
Perform system-level data integration across multiple sites and multiple subject areas for:
Data validation for flight software certification
Electrical channelization resource management
Telemetry definition, mapping, and downlink
Qualification
Required
Experience with electrical integration functions
Experience coordinating with multiple engineering functions (Mechanical, Electrical, Systems, Flight Sciences, Materials, Manufacturing, Test, etc.)
Active or Current Secret Security Clearance
Bachelor's or higher degree in Engineering, Math, Physics, or other related field or equivalent work experience
Experience with telemetry systems, flight operations, electrical component or harness design, and/or avionics integration and test
9+ years' engineering experience
Proven understanding of systems thinking skills and behaviors
Missile or space segment design and test experience with one or more subsystems or fields outside of Systems Engineering
Electrical compatibility analysis experience, testing and troubleshooting
System level architecture design including flight termination systems, telemetry, flight computers, thrust vector control, and or power distribution
RF communication and or network design
Active or Current Top Secret Security Clearance
